/* color schemes */
.search-box #searchbox {
  white-space: nowrap;
  line-height: 26px; }
.search-box .header_search_input {
  border-style: solid;
  border-width: 1px;
  border-left-width: 0;
  width: 100%;
  font-size: 13px;
  padding: 0 10px;
  height: 28px;
  display: inline-block;
  outline: none; }
.search-box .button-search {
  display: inline-block;
  outline: none;
  padding: 0;
  background: none;
  border: none;
  position: absolute;
  right: 5px;
  bottom: 0;
  font-size: 11px;
  -webkit-transform: scaleX(-1);
  transform: scaleX(-1);
  line-height: 28px; }

#searchbox {
  position: relative; }

.search-box {
  float: right; }
  .search-box label {
    color: #333333; }

@media (max-width: 1199px) {
  .search-box .header_search_input {
    font-size: 12px; } }
.amazingsearch_result {
  padding: 15px 10px;
  position: absolute;
  top: 100%;
  left: 15px;
  right: 15px;
  margin-top: 15px;
  display: none;
  background-color: #ffffff;
  z-index: 200;
  line-height: 1.3; }
  .amazingsearch_result .product_img_link {
    display: inline-block; }

.products_list_block .header {
  display: none; }

.amazingsearch_result .products_list {
  font-size: 0;
  display: table;
  width: 100%; }
.amazingsearch_result .ajax_block_product {
  width: 25%;
  float: none;
  display: inline-block;
  vertical-align: top;
  font-size: 14px; }

/* search active */
.amazing-search .styled-select .dl dt.option,
.amazing-search select {
  border: 1px solid #2a333c;
  border-right-width: 0; }
.amazing-search .styled-select {
  position: absolute;
  top: 0;
  right: 100%;
  z-index: 102; }
.amazing-search select {
  position: absolute;
  top: 0;
  right: 100%;
  z-index: 102;
  height: 28px;
  padding-left: 15px; }
.amazing-search .styled-select select {
  display: none; }
.amazing-search .styled-select .option {
  padding-top: 1px;
  padding-bottom: 0;
  height: 28px;
  line-height: 28px;
  color: #333333; }
.amazing-search .styled-select .dl i.toggle {
  line-height: 28px; }
.amazing-search .styled-select i.toggle {
  color: #fff;
  border-left: none; }
.amazing-search .styled-select ul {
  background: #2e3641;
  border: none; }
.amazing-search option {
  background: #2e3641;
  border: none; }
.amazing-search .styled-select li.option,
.amazing-search option {
  background: none;
  color: #fff; }
.amazing-search .styled-select:not(.mobile) li.option:hover {
  background: #141619; }
.amazing-search .styled-select li:not(:last-child) {
  border-bottom-color: #141619; }
.amazing-search .styled-select dt.option {
  border: none;
  background-color: #2e3641;
  color: #fff; }
.amazing-search select {
  border: none;
  background-color: #2e3641;
  color: #fff;
  background-image: url(../../../../../img/icon/arrow-down-alt.svg); }

.amazing-search .styled-select li.option:hover:before {
  border-color: #141619; }

@media (min-width: 769px) and (max-width: 991px) {
  .amazingsearch_result .ajax_block_product {
    width: 33.333%; } }
/* mobile */
@media (max-width: 768px) {
  .amazingsearch_result .ajax_block_product {
    width: 50%; }

  .amazing-search {
    display: none;
    margin-top: 60px;
    padding: 0; }
    .amazing-search .styled-select,
    .amazing-search select {
      left: 0;
      right: auto;
      width: 110px;
      z-index: 10; }
    .amazing-search .header_search_input {
      padding-left: 120px; } }
@media (max-width: 480px) {
  .amazingsearch_result .ajax_block_product {
    width: 100%; } }

/*# sourceMappingURL=amazingsearch.css.map */
